公司简介
Arista Networks 是数据驱动的客户端到云网络领域的行业领导者,专注于大型数据中心、校园和路由环境。我们的与众不同之处在于我们对创新的不懈追求。我们利用云计算、人工智能和软件定义网络的最新进展,为客户在日益互联的世界中提供竞争优势。我们的解决方案不仅旨在满足当前数字环境的需求,还能预测和适应未来的挑战。
在 Arista,我们重视每位员工带来的多元化思维和观点。我们相信,营造一个包容的环境,让来自不同背景和经验的个人感到受欢迎,对于推动创造力和创新至关重要。
我们对卓越的承诺使我们获得了多个著名奖项,例如最佳工程团队、最佳多元化公司、薪酬和工作与生活平衡奖。在 Arista,我们为我们的成功记录感到自豪,并努力在我们所做的一切中保持最高的质量和性能标准。
职位描述
您将与谁合作
Arista Networks 正在寻找候选人加入专业服务(软件开发)团队。这个团队是一个全球软件工程师团队,致力于交付高质量和强大的软件,帮助 Arista 的客户和内部同事实现他们的目标并解决有趣的现实问题。
您将做什么
团队的工作可以分为三个主要领域:
- 网络自动化:通过利用尖端的网络自动化技术为客户开发创新框架
- 软件定制:设计和实施解决方案,帮助客户部署和操作先进的网络基础设施
- 效率提升:构建软件工具,帮助内部和外部合作者在部署、迁移和操作网络时更高效地工作
资格要求
- 计算机科学或相关领域的硕士或学士学位(或同等经验)
- 3年以上专业软件开发经验
- 精通 Python、Golang 或 Rust
- 精通版本控制系统(例如 GitHub、GitLab、Bitbucket)
- 了解测试框架(例如 PyTest、GoMock)
- 理解 IP 网络和/或分布式系统
- 有 Unix 或 Linux 的经验
- 熟悉软件开发生命周期的各个阶段
- 具有优秀的沟通技能
- 具备出色的问题解决、分析和故障排除能力
- 能够独立工作,也能在团队中有效协作
- 具有敏锐的智力,愿意不断学习和发展
- 了解和/或愿意使用 AI 工具来提高软件开发生产力
期望经验
- 有 CI 平台(例如 GitHub、GitLab、Jenkins)的经验
- 熟悉使用 GCP 设计和实施可扩展的基于云的 Web 应用程序
- 熟悉使用 IaC(基础设施即代码)工具(如 Terraform)创建和管理基于云的基础设施
- 熟悉容器技术(例如 Docker、Podman、Kubernetes)和服务编排(例如 Ansible、Terraform)
- 熟悉 Nautobot 或 Netbox
- 有数据中心网络、管理和编排的经验
- 有构建第三方软件集成和 API 的经验
- 有客户面对面角色的工作经验
#LI-PA1
附加信息
该职位的新员工基本工资范围为 89,000 美元至 140,000 美元。Arista 根据工作地点提供不同的薪资范围,以便我们能够提供与市场相符的稳定和有竞争力的薪酬。实际提供的基本工资将基于多种因素,包括技能、资格、相关经验和工作地点。
所提供的薪资范围仅反映基本工资,此外某些职位可能还有资格获得 Arista 的酌情奖金和股权。销售职位的员工有资格参与 Arista 的销售激励计划,该计划根据符合条件的销售额按百分比支付佣金。员工还享有包括医疗、牙科、视力、健康、收入保护和团体退休储蓄计划在内的福利。招聘团队可以在招聘过程中根据具体职位和地点分享更多详细信息。